Optimal Heat Level Stability

Preserving consistent temperatures stands as the primary benefit of a specialized wine preservation unit. Variations in heat expose stoppers to contraction, allowing oxygen seepage that causes oxidation. A high-quality wine cooler eliminates this hazard by holding settings typically between 45°F and 65°F, customizable for white or sparkling types. This accuracy ensures every bottle stays at its perfect storage state perpetually.

Conventional freezers function at lower levels, often around 37°F, which stifles taste development and renders tannins unpleasant. Additionally, their frequent operation creates harmful shifts in internal environment. A wine cooler’s thermoelectric system counteracts this by delivering steady cooling without sudden drops, preserving the integrity of vintage wines.

Humidity Control Basics

Proper humidity levels serve a pivotal function in avoiding cork stopper deterioration. When corks dehydrate, they shrink, allowing air intrusion that spoils the wine. Alternatively, high humidity promotes mold growth on identifiers and packaging. A well-designed wine cooler maintains 50-80% relative humidity, a range impossible to attain in arid cabinet environments.

This equilibrium is accomplished via integrated moisture systems that monitor and regulate levels automatically. Unlike standard appliances, which remove moisture from the air, wine coolers preserve necessary dampness to maintain closures flexible and sealed. This feature is particularly vital for long-term cellaring, where minor deviations lead to permanent damage.

Protection from Light and Vibration

Ultraviolet light and vibrations pose silent yet severe threats to wine quality. Contact to sunlight degrades chemical elements in wine, resulting in premature deterioration and "unpleasant" flavors. Additionally, persistent shaking agitate sediment, accelerating molecular reactions that lessen complexity. A wine refrigerator mitigates these issues with tinted glass and stabilized mechanisms.

High-end units feature dual-paned entryways that filter 99% of damaging UV light, establishing a light-controlled sanctuary for stored containers. Simultaneously, sophisticated compressor technologies employ rubber supports or thermoelectric configurations to minimize mechanical vibrations. This dual protection assures fragile years stay undisturbed by outside forces.

Space Optimization and Organization

Disorganization impedes efficient wine organization, leading to forgotten bottles or inadvertent breakage. A Beverage wine cooler solves this with customizable racking configured for varying bottle dimensions. Metal racks prevent scrapes, while angled designs showcase labels for easy selection. Furthermore, modular options maximize height capacity in small areas.

For extensive collections, zoning capabilities enable separate climate sections within a single appliance. This versatility permits concurrent keeping of red, sparkling, and dessert wines at their respective ideal temperatures. This structuring converts messy cellars into elegant, accessible displays, enhancing both utility and aesthetic attractiveness.

Energy Efficiency and Sustainability

Modern wine coolers emphasize power efficiency without sacrificing performance. Innovations like LED lighting, enhanced sealing, and inverter motors drastically reduce electricity consumption compared to older models. Many appliances carry ENERGY STAR® certifications, indicating adherence to strict ecological guidelines.

Such efficiency converts to sustained financial reduction and a reduced carbon impact. Contrary to conventional refrigerators, which operate frequently, wine coolers activate refrigeration only when needed, maintaining temperatures with minimal energy consumption. Furthermore, eco-friendly refrigerants lessen ozone damage, aligning with environmentally aware lifestyles.
